Is bamboo or silk better?

Bamboo is a breathable fabric and a lot more comfortable, temperature-wise than silk. In other words, bamboo helps you regulate your temperature while you sleep. Bamboo is machine washable whereas silk is not. It needs to be hand washed and air dried or dry cleaned to maintain its quality.

What are the disadvantages of bamboo fabric?

Cons of Bamboo Fabric

The chemicals used to process the fabric are harmful to human health and the environment. Shrinkage of the Fabric: Bamboo fabric tends to shrink at a faster rate compared to cotton. Expensive: Natural bamboo fabric tends to be more expensive than the rayon type or even cotton.

What are the disadvantages of silk?

Sun and Water Damage. Silk is highly susceptible to damage from the elements. Even a tiny bit of water can leave a visible stain that's impossible to get rid of. And sunlight weakens the fibers of silk, resulting in tearing and fading.

What is the difference between bamboo and silk?

Bamboo has antibacterial and antifungal properties with odour resistant fibres. Silk is naturally hypoallergenic, resistant to mould and mildew along with bamboo. Silk sheets are much more expensive than bamboo and rough areas of skin and fingernails easily damage silk material.

Are bamboo clothes breathable?

For instance, bamboo fabric is highly breathable, and it is also stretchier than cotton. It's easy to weave this fabric into fabrics with high thread counts, and the resulting textiles are often thinner than their cotton counterparts while remaining similar or greater in tensility.
